What 1GCDT198-5 means
1GC
DT198
·
5
- 1GC
- the World Manufacturer Identifier Chevrolet registered — assembled in the United States
- DT198
- together encode the Colorado line — 2.8L 4cyl, Four-wheel drive — as Chevrolet filed it, these five characters are read as one block, not letter by letter
- 5
- in position 10 — model year 2005
- 9, 11–17
- vehicle-specific fields: check digit, plant code and production sequence
